Apple Dividend Payout Slows as Stock Growth Falters
Apple will distribute its next quarterly dividend of $27 per 100 shares on August 13, 2026, to shareholders who own the stock by August 10. This move comes as Apple's stock growth has slowed in recent years. From 2016 to 2021, the tech giant's stock increased by about 450%, but over the past five years, it has only grown around 108%.
This divergence from previous trends raises questions about whether Apple will follow Nvidia's lead and increase its dividend payouts. The company's recent price volatility, including a 10% drop after earnings, may also indicate that investors are turning to dividends as a more reliable source of income rather than relying solely on capital gains.
